District Overview

L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S is a public school district in New Mexico serving 3,724 students across 8 schools. It includes 5 elementary, 1 middle, 1 high schools. Its graduation rate of 91.0% is above the national average of 86.5%. Per-pupil spending of $14,273 is near the national average for a US public school district. Only 13% of students q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, suggesting a relatively low-poverty student body. Opportunity scores across its schools are moderate, with a district median of 51/100.

District Finances
Per-Pupil Expenditure$14,273Near national avg
National avg $14,347
Revenue Sources
61%
21%
State
61.1%
Local (property tax)
20.6%
Federal
18.3%

State funding accounts for 61% of the budget — this district relies more on state aid than local tax revenue.

Source: NCES F-33 School District Finance Survey. District-level data.

Frequently Asked Questions
How many schools are in L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S?
L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S has 8 public schools, serving a total of 3,724 students.
What is the graduation rate for L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S?
The graduation rate is 91.0%, which is above the national average of 86.5%.
How much does L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S spend per student?
L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S spends $14,273 per pupil — 1% below the national average of $14,347.
What percentage of students qualify for free or reduced-price lunch in L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S?
13% of students in L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, compared to the national rate of 52.2%.
Are there charter schools in L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S?
No, L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S does not currently include any charter schools.
What grade levels does L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S serve?
L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S serves grades PK through 12, covering elementary, middle, and high school levels.
What is the opportunity score for L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S?
The median opportunity score across schools in LOS ALAMOS PUBLIC SCHOOLS is 51/100. The national median is 50/100. Opportunity scores reflect long-term economic mobility prospects for children who grow up in these communities.
